Ingredients for Crescent Roll Dough Recipes

  • 1 package (16 ounces) refrigerated crescent roll dough
  • 1/2 cup melted butter
  • 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
  • Salt and pepper to taste

These are the core ingredients; however, consider exploring substitutions to tailor the flavor profile to your preference. For instance, substitute mozzarella with provolone for a tangy variation. Similarly, substitute parsley with fresh chives or oregano for an alternative herby note.

Step-by-Step Preparation of Crescent Roll Dough Recipes

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king sheet.
  2. Unroll the crescent roll dough and spread the melted butter evenly over the dough. Sprinkle the mozzarella and Parmesan cheeses, and chopped parsley over the butter.
  3. Carefully fold the dough in half, sealing the edges firmly to create a neat package. Fold and crimp the edges to ensure a secure seal.
  4. Cut the dough into 6-8 equal-sized portions.
  5. Place the portions onto the prepared baking sheet, ensuring they are spaced apart.
  6.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  7.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until golden brown and the cheese is melted and bubbly.
  8. Let cool slightly before serving.

FAQ

Q: What are the best substitutions for the mozzarella cheese?

A: Provolone, fontina, or even a blend of cheeses can be substituted for a unique flavor profile.

Q: Can I prepare this recipe ahead of time?

A: The dough can be prepared ahead of time and stored in the refrigerator. The baking step should be done closer to serving time.

What fillings pair best with crescent roll dough?

Savory fillings like cheese, spinach, or vegetables complement the dough’s flavor beautifully. Sweet fillings like fruit preserves, chocolate, or custard provide a delightful contrast.

How can I store leftover crescent rolls to maintain freshness?

Store leftover rolls in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days or in the refrigerator for up to a week. Reheating them in the oven or microwave will restore their original texture.

What are some tips for achieving a perfect crescent roll shape?

Proper chilling, careful layering, and gentle handling of the dough are crucial. Use a sharp knife or pastry cutter for precise cuts and avoid overstretching the dough. Practice makes perfect!
